Nat's banana cake

Ingredients
  • 125g butter/margarine
  • 3/4 cup castor sugar
  • Teaspoon vanilla essence
  • 2 eggs
  • 2 ripe bananas
  • 1 1/2 cups Self Raising flour
  • 1/4 Teaspoon bi-carb soda
  • 1/4 cup milk
Method
  1. Pre-heat oven to 180 degrees.
  2. Cream butter, sugar and essence then beat in eggs one at a time.
  3. Mash bananas with fork.
  4. Add bananas to mixture and beat in.
  5. Fold in sifted flour and soda.
  6. Stir in milk.
  7. Line 20cm square or similar round cake tin with baking paper.
  8. Pour in mixture.
  9. Bake in moderate oven - 45 mins.
  10. Slightly less for fan forced oven.
  11. Let cool for 5 mins before turning out.
  12. Icing - icing sugar mixed with margarine and philly cream cheese.
